We all know as Internet marketers that it takes time to build up a steady stream of traffic from the search engines. So while your waiting for that traffic to show up why not get ready for it and that is the focus for today’s affiliate marketing tips.

Writing articles just for search engine traffic!

Yesterday I am sure a lot of you were wandering why I wrote about the offer I found from the Hydra Network that was pertaining to saving money of fuel. Well, the reason why I did that was because down the road (I always think of a year from now, not tomorrow) when gas prices really get bad there is going to be a lot of people searching for information on how to save money with there fuel for there cars and I want that article to be in there face when that time hits, and when they use my affiliate link guess who gets paid. There is nothing wrong with writing an article or a review with your affiliate link built in it, lots of marketers do this on a daily basis.

Some affiliate marketers would build an affiliate website based on an idea like that, and in most cases that would be a very smart thing to do. But if you can build up back links to an article to give it more authority and help it get more search traffic then why not just take a few minuets and write a great post or review on an offer then post it. Your going to make money off of it at some point and the nice thing is it didn’t cost you much to do other then your time.

This method may not work with every offer that’s out there simply because some offers die down in popularity after a few months, but with the fuel crises that’s around right now and that will be around forever I felt that article from yesterday would be a very sound investment for me.

So when your looking at your offers and decided what you want to do, don’t forget about your blog and the power of it!!
